Home
last modified time | relevance | path

Searched defs:ibqp (Results 1 – 25 of 48) sorted by relevance

12

/Linux-v5.4/drivers/infiniband/hw/vmw_pvrdma/
Dpvrdma_qp.c475 int pvrdma_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in pvrdma_modify_qp()
618 int pvrdma_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in pvrdma_post_send()
828 int pvrdma_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in pvrdma_post_recv()
921 int pvrdma_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in pvrdma_query_qp()
/Linux-v5.4/drivers/infiniband/hw/usnic/
Dusnic_ib_qp_grp.h49 struct ib_qp ibqp; member
105 struct usnic_ib_qp_grp *to_uqp_grp(struct ib_qp *ibqp) in to_uqp_grp()
/Linux-v5.4/drivers/infiniband/hw/mthca/
Dmthca_mcg.c120 int mthca_multicast_attach(struct ib_qp *ibqp, union ib_gid *gid, u16 lid) in mthca_multicast_attach()
214 int mthca_multicast_detach(struct ib_qp *ibqp, union ib_gid *gid, u16 lid) in mthca_multicast_detach()
Dmthca_qp.c430 int mthca_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, int qp_attr_mask, in mthca_query_qp()
556 static int __mthca_modify_qp(struct ib_qp *ibqp, in __mthca_modify_qp()
858 int mthca_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, int attr_mask, in mthca_modify_qp()
1623 int mthca_tavor_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in mthca_tavor_post_send()
1821 int mthca_tavor_post_receive(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in mthca_tavor_post_receive()
1926 int mthca_arbel_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in mthca_arbel_post_send()
2160 int mthca_arbel_post_receive(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in mthca_arbel_post_receive()
Dmthca_provider.h262 struct ib_qp ibqp; member
334 static inline struct mthca_qp *to_mqp(struct ib_qp *ibqp) in to_mqp()
/Linux-v5.4/drivers/infiniband/sw/rxe/
Drxe_verbs.c461 static int rxe_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in rxe_modify_qp()
482 static int rxe_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in rxe_query_qp()
493 static int rxe_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in rxe_destroy_qp()
718 static int rxe_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in rxe_post_send()
741 static int rxe_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in rxe_post_recv()
1046 static int rxe_attach_mcast(struct ib_qp *ibqp, union ib_gid *mgid, u16 mlid) in rxe_attach_mcast()
1064 static int rxe_detach_mcast(struct ib_qp *ibqp, union ib_gid *mgid, u16 mlid) in rxe_detach_mcast()
/Linux-v5.4/drivers/infiniband/sw/rdmavt/
Dmcast.c280 int rvt_attach_mcast(struct ib_qp *ibqp, union ib_gid *gid, u16 lid) in rvt_attach_mcast()
343 int rvt_detach_mcast(struct ib_qp *ibqp, union ib_gid *gid, u16 lid) in rvt_detach_mcast()
Dqp.c1422 int rvt_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in rvt_modify_qp()
1693 int rvt_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in rvt_destroy_qp()
1740 int rvt_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in rvt_query_qp()
1803 int rvt_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in rvt_post_recv()
2164 int rvt_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in rvt_post_send()
2553 struct ib_qp *ibqp = &qp->ibqp; in rvt_add_retry_timer_ext() local
/Linux-v5.4/drivers/infiniband/hw/qedr/
Dqedr_iw_cm.c159 struct ib_qp *ibqp = &ep->qp->ibqp; in qedr_iw_qp_event() local
730 void qedr_iw_qp_add_ref(struct ib_qp *ibqp) in qedr_iw_qp_add_ref()
737 void qedr_iw_qp_rem_ref(struct ib_qp *ibqp) in qedr_iw_qp_rem_ref()
Dqedr_roce_cm.c543 int qedr_gsi_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in qedr_gsi_post_send()
613 int qedr_gsi_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in qedr_gsi_post_recv()
Dverbs.c1007 static inline int get_gid_info_from_table(struct ib_qp *ibqp, in get_gid_info_from_table()
1877 struct ib_qp *ibqp; in qedr_create_qp() local
2091 int qedr_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in qedr_modify_qp()
2362 int qedr_query_qp(struct ib_qp *ibqp, in qedr_query_qp()
2448 int qedr_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in qedr_destroy_qp()
3153 static int __qedr_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in __qedr_post_send()
3368 int qedr_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in qedr_post_send()
3527 int qedr_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in qedr_post_recv()
/Linux-v5.4/drivers/infiniband/hw/hns/
Dhns_roce_hw_v2.c159 static int set_rwqe_data_seg(struct ib_qp *ibqp, const struct ib_send_wr *wr, in set_rwqe_data_seg()
229 static int hns_roce_v2_post_send(struct ib_qp *ibqp, in hns_roce_v2_post_send()
613 static int hns_roce_v2_post_recv(struct ib_qp *ibqp, in hns_roce_v2_post_recv()
3253 static void modify_qp_reset_to_init(struct ib_qp *ibqp, in modify_qp_reset_to_init()
3546 static void modify_qp_init_to_init(struct ib_qp *ibqp, in modify_qp_init_to_init()
3663 static int modify_qp_init_to_rtr(struct ib_qp *ibqp, in modify_qp_init_to_rtr()
3909 static int modify_qp_rtr_to_rts(struct ib_qp *ibqp, in modify_qp_rtr_to_rts()
4053 static int hns_roce_v2_set_path(struct ib_qp *ibqp, in hns_roce_v2_set_path()
4155 static int hns_roce_v2_set_abs_fields(struct ib_qp *ibqp, in hns_roce_v2_set_abs_fields()
4196 static int hns_roce_v2_set_opt_fields(struct ib_qp *ibqp, in hns_roce_v2_set_opt_fields()
[all …]
Dhns_roce_hw_v1.c61 static int hns_roce_v1_post_send(struct ib_qp *ibqp, in hns_roce_v1_post_send()
347 static int hns_roce_v1_post_recv(struct ib_qp *ibqp, in hns_roce_v1_post_recv()
2571 static int hns_roce_v1_m_sqp(struct ib_qp *ibqp, const struct ib_qp_attr *attr, in hns_roce_v1_m_sqp()
2716 static int hns_roce_v1_m_qp(struct ib_qp *ibqp, const struct ib_qp_attr *attr, in hns_roce_v1_m_qp()
3326 static int hns_roce_v1_modify_qp(struct ib_qp *ibqp, in hns_roce_v1_modify_qp()
3384 static int hns_roce_v1_q_sqp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, in hns_roce_v1_q_sqp()
3454 static int hns_roce_v1_q_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, in hns_roce_v1_q_qp()
3596 static int hns_roce_v1_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, in hns_roce_v1_query_qp()
3607 int hns_roce_v1_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in hns_roce_v1_destroy_qp()
Dhns_roce_qp.c72 struct ib_qp *ibqp = &hr_qp->ibqp; in hns_roce_ib_qp_event() local
1125 static int hns_roce_check_qp_attr(struct ib_qp *ibqp, struct ib_qp_attr *attr, in hns_roce_check_qp_attr()
1172 int hns_roce_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in hns_roce_modify_qp()
/Linux-v5.4/drivers/infiniband/hw/mlx4/
Dqp.c232 struct ib_qp *ibqp = &to_mibqp(qp)->ibqp; in mlx4_ib_qp_event() local
1649 struct ib_qp *ibqp; in mlx4_ib_create_qp() local
2165 struct ib_qp *ibqp; in __mlx4_ib_modify_qp() local
2718 static int _mlx4_ib_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in _mlx4_ib_modify_qp()
2846 int mlx4_ib_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in mlx4_ib_modify_qp()
3525 static int _mlx4_ib_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in _mlx4_ib_post_send()
3841 int mlx4_ib_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in mlx4_ib_post_send()
3847 static int _mlx4_ib_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in _mlx4_ib_post_recv()
3935 int mlx4_ib_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in mlx4_ib_post_recv()
4014 int mlx4_ib_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, int qp_attr_mask, in mlx4_ib_query_qp()
/Linux-v5.4/drivers/infiniband/hw/i40iw/
Di40iw_verbs.c404 static int i40iw_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in i40iw_destroy_qp()
756 static int i40iw_query_qp(struct ib_qp *ibqp, in i40iw_query_qp()
837 int i40iw_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in i40iw_modify_qp()
1644 static void i40iw_drain_sq(struct ib_qp *ibqp) in i40iw_drain_sq()
1657 static void i40iw_drain_rq(struct ib_qp *ibqp) in i40iw_drain_rq()
2115 static int i40iw_post_send(struct ib_qp *ibqp, in i40iw_post_send()
2292 static int i40iw_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*ib_wr, in i40iw_post_recv()
/Linux-v5.4/drivers/infiniband/hw/cxgb3/
Diwch_qp.c351 int iwch_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in iwch_post_send()
466 int iwch_post_receive(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in iwch_post_receive()
Diwch_provider.h162 struct ib_qp ibqp; member
178 static inline struct iwch_qp *to_iwch_qp(struct ib_qp *ibqp) in to_iwch_qp()
/Linux-v5.4/drivers/infiniband/hw/hfi1/
Dqp.c219 struct ib_qp *ibqp = &qp->ibqp; in hfi1_check_modify_qp() local
281 struct ib_qp *ibqp = &qp->ibqp; in hfi1_modify_qp() local
Dopfn.c244 struct ib_qp *ibqp = &qp->ibqp; in opfn_qp_init() local
/Linux-v5.4/drivers/infiniband/hw/efa/
Defa_verbs.c135 static inline struct efa_qp *to_eqp(struct ib_qp *ibqp) in to_eqp()
349 int efa_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, in efa_query_qp()
488 int efa_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in efa_destroy_qp()
821 int efa_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, in efa_modify_qp()
/Linux-v5.4/drivers/infiniband/hw/cxgb4/
Dqp.c1076 int c4iw_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in c4iw_post_send()
1260 int c4iw_post_receive(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in c4iw_post_receive()
2367 int c4iw_ib_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in c4iw_ib_modify_qp()
2463 int c4iw_ib_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in c4iw_ib_query_qp()
Drestrack.c140 struct ib_qp *ibqp = container_of(res, struct ib_qp, res); in fill_res_qp_entry() local
/Linux-v5.4/drivers/infiniband/hw/ocrdma/
Docrdma_verbs.c1380 int _ocrdma_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in _ocrdma_modify_qp()
1400 int ocrdma_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in ocrdma_modify_qp()
1468 int ocrdma_query_qp(struct ib_qp *ibqp, in ocrdma_query_qp()
1684 int ocrdma_destroy_qp(struct ib_qp *ibqp, struct ib_udata *udata) in ocrdma_destroy_qp()
2101 int ocrdma_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in ocrdma_post_send()
2234 int ocrdma_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in ocrdma_post_recv()
/Linux-v5.4/drivers/infiniband/hw/mlx5/
Dqp.c285 struct ib_qp *ibqp = &to_mibqp(qp)->ibqp; in mlx5_ib_qp_event() local
3195 struct mlx5_ib_qp *ibqp = sq->base.container_mibqp; in modify_raw_packet_qp_sq() local
3411 static int __mlx5_ib_modify_qp(struct ib_qp *ibqp, in __mlx5_ib_modify_qp()
3799 static int mlx5_ib_modify_dct(struct ib_qp *ibqp, struct ib_qp_attr *attr, in mlx5_ib_modify_dct()
3891 int mlx5_ib_modify_qp(struct ib_qp *ibqp, struct ib_qp_attr *attr, in mlx5_ib_modify_qp()
4964 static int _mlx5_ib_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in _mlx5_ib_post_send()
5346 int mlx5_ib_post_send(struct ib_qp *ibqp, const struct ib_send_wr *wr, in mlx5_ib_post_send()
5357 static int _mlx5_ib_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in _mlx5_ib_post_recv()
5437 int mlx5_ib_post_recv(struct ib_qp *ibqp, const struct ib_recv_wr *wr, in mlx5_ib_post_recv()
5757 int mlx5_ib_query_qp(struct ib_qp *ibqp, struct ib_qp_attr *qp_attr, in mlx5_ib_query_qp()

12